Perst is a fast and embeddable NoSQL database for Java and .NET applications. Perst stores data directly in Java or C# objects, removing the need for ORM or SQL mappings.
#What is Perst?
Perst Database is an object-oriented, open-source database management system designed to work on embedded devices with limited resources. It is a lightweight, high-performance database system that offers both in-memory and persistent storage options. Perst Database can be used in a variety of applications, including mobile devices, real-time systems, and Internet of Things (IoT) devices.
#Perst Key Features
Features of Perst Database:
- Supports a wide range of data types, including primitive types, collections, and user-defined classes.
- Provides an efficient indexing mechanism that allows for fast data retrieval.
- Offers seamless integration with Java and .NET languages.
- Supports ACID transactions and offers a flexible locking mechanism to ensure data consistency.
- Provides seamless integration with object-oriented programming languages.
- Offers both in-memory and persistent storage options.
Use cases of Perst Database:
- Mobile applications: Perst Database can be used to store data in mobile applications that require high-performance and efficient storage options.
- Real-time systems: Perst Database can be used in real-time systems that require low-latency and high-speed data access.
- IoT devices: Perst Database is suitable for IoT devices that have limited storage and processing capabilities.
Perst Database is a lightweight, high-performance, open-source database management system that supports a wide range of data types and can be used in various applications, including mobile devices, real-time systems, and IoT devices.